Output 756985db89ac9ee90dbea61e20b03c54158af96082e234a0b9f7ff58df59a740:28

value
41296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2e52f269ffff049c6551132269149eed0616e5 OP_EQUAL
address
3PDptTtkFingXhVcqPqmh3Cak8F86LD4oL
transaction
756985db89ac9ee90dbea61e20b03c54158af96082e234a0b9f7ff58df59a740
spent
true